Get Your Interior Cleaned



The first step in spring cleaning your car is to get the interior clean. Start by vacuuming the seats, carpets, and floor mats. Be sure to use a crevice tool to clean all of the nooks and crannies. If you have any stains or spills, use a stain remover to take care of them. You may also want to consider removing your floor mats if they're rubber and rinsing them with water and a mild detergent.

Replace The Wiper Blades



If your wiper blades are starting to show signs of wear and tear, it's time to replace them. Traditional wipers can't remove as much water and snow as fresh ones, making driving in inclement weather hazardous. This part of car ownership is probably one of the simplest, yet most overlooked, aspects of spring cleaning and maintenance. Having clear visibility is essential with the heavy rains that spring often brings.

Wash Your Car



After you've cleaned the inside of your car, it's time to move on to the outside. Start by cleaning your windows and mirrors with a glass cleaner. Be sure to use lint-free cloth so that you don't leave any streaks behind. To really make your car shine, wash and wax it. This will remove any dirt, grime, or pollen that has built up over time and leave your car with a protective layer that will make it easier to clean in the future. The best way to clean your car is to start at the top and work down. Also, try to work in an area out of direct sunlight to avoid soap drying on your vehicle and needing to start over again.

How To Clean Tires



Your
tires can get pretty dirty over time, so it's important to clean them regularly. The best way to clean your tires is with a tire cleaner and a brush. Start by spraying the cleaner on your tires and then scrubbing them with a brush. You may need to let the cleaner sit for a few minutes before rinsing it off. Declutter Your Trunk



If your trunk is cluttered, it can be difficult to find things when you need them. Start by getting rid of any unnecessary items. If you don't use it often, consider storing it in your home. Then, install some storage containers to organize the rest of your belongings. Did you know that less weight in your vehicle can also help you achieve better fuel efficiency? Check Under the Hood



It's important to regularly check under the hood of your car to make sure everything is in working order. This spring, take a look at your battery and give it a clean if necessary. Check the level of your coolant and add more if it's low. Finally, take a look at your hoses and belts to make sure they're not warped or cracked. Don't forget to remove any twigs or leaves that can get into your engine. A good time to check under your hood is before you fill up your gas tank.

Don't Forget Spring Maintenance



Once you've cleaned and decluttered your car, it's time to focus on maintenance. This is the perfect time to get your
oil changed and rotate your tires. You should also have your brakes checked to ensure they're in good condition. Since summer won't be far away either, it wouldn't hurt to have an AC system inspection as well.
